The Texture Feature Extraction of Agricultural Field Images by HOG Algorithms and Soil Moisture Estimation based on the Texture Features

Özet: Knowing the value of soil surface moisture in the agricultural areas are very important in many ways such as minimizing the harmful effects of drought cases, preventing salinity caused by over watering, protecting agricultural lands and using the irrigation system efficiently. The main purpose of this study is that determining a relationship between measurements of local soil moisture and images in agricultural Mardin region and prediction of soil moisture with the determined relationship. The images are derived from TARBIL (http://www.tarbil.org) database. The texture feature vectors are extracted from the images by using Histogram of Oriented Gradients (HOG) algorithm. The obtained feature vectors are then classified into three (much, middle and little) groups by using k-Nearest Neighbor (k-NN) and Multilayer Perceptron (MLP) classifiers.
